Output f24f08672e24ade16d128a3e00cdc354fd63ea1a5ceb995aaa7b3a9700c4b9b3:1

value
2648651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2c87c7a3d64a761e3ab8ad71221852173325d29 OP_EQUAL
address
3GXjZeZgYg5GFoEKadfzGjoTW3pTrtxwPj
transaction
f24f08672e24ade16d128a3e00cdc354fd63ea1a5ceb995aaa7b3a9700c4b9b3
confirmations
173150
spent
true